Air Cars London

Air Cars London

0  Reviews


Taxis in London
10-16 Tiller Rd , London, E14 8PX
020 8507 0600

Air Cars London is a taxi company in London who specialises in taxis and private taxi hire. Air Cars taxi company is located at the following address - 10-16 Tiller Rd.




Are you willing to write a short review of Air Cars London? Tell us about your experiences by writing a Air Cars London review and help build a list of the best Taxis in London. If Air Cars London is owned by you, then claim it today. If you claim a business, it will enable you to update the business contact details.